Pinpointing Reliable Information for Hazardous Materials
When dealing with hazardous materials, obtaining reliable information is essential. A credible reference can offer you with accurate insights about the properties of dangerous chemicals. Consult government agencies, industry organizations, and scientific publications for detailed information.
- Agencies like OSHA and the EPA offer valuable guidelines for the safe management of hazardous materials.
- Industrial data sheets (SDSs) contain comprehensive data about specific chemicals and existing hazards.
- Research journals often publish latest studies on hazardous materials.
